United Rentals to sell Doosan

I have a friend that works for United Rentals and he told me that they can now sell Doosan lift trucks. I have been working for a local material handling company for 16 years. We picked up Doosan in the early 90's. My friend went on to tell me that he can get a 5000# pnuematic, ss, 186 tsu, dual fuel, strobe light, and b/u alarm for $17,500.00 his cost. That is a few thousand less that I can get them for. Does anyone know if there is any truth to this??

Thanks

Fact of the week
Foundling hatches are safe, anonymous drop-off points for unwanted infants, allowing parents in crisis a way to surrender a baby safely without fear of punishment, ensuring the child is rescued and cared for. The concept started in the 12th century, was abandoned in the late 19th century, then reintroduced in 1952. It has since been adopted in many countries.
